Nigeria’s Ese Brume Wins Fourth Gold Medal in Women’s Long Jump at African Championships

Nigeria’s Ese Brume has secured the Gold Medal in the Women’s Long Jump Event at the 2024 African Senior Athletics Championships held in Douala, Cameroon.

Brume’s triumph came during her final attempt, where she leaped an impressive six point seven three meters to clinch the top spot on the podium.

Brume is the first Athlete, male or female, to claim four consecutive titles in the history of the African Athletics Championships, underscoring her unparalleled dominance in the sport across the continent for a decade.

In other performances, Nigeria’s Temitope Adeshina secured the Silver Medal in the Women’s High Jump Event, while Samuel Ogazi attained third place finish in the men’s 400 meters final.
